EXECUTIVE ORDER NO. 40
ADVANCING THE JUVENILE JUSTICE PLANNING COMMITTEE
WHEREAS, effective juvenile justice policies and programs promote public safety, improve outcomes for juveniles and their families, and enhance juveniles' long-term educational, employment, and life prospects, making North Carolina safer and stronger; and
WHEREAS, the Executive Organization Act of 1973 established the Governor’s Crime Commission; and
WHEREAS, N.C. Gen. Stat. § 143B-1102 establishes the Juvenile Justice Planning Committee (the “Committee”) as an adjunct committee to advise the Governor’s Crime Commission on matters referred to it that are relevant to juvenile justice; and
WHEREAS, the federal Juvenile Justice and Delinquency Prevention Act of 1974, Pub. L. No. 93-415 (1974), as amended through Pub. L. 115-385 (Dec. 21, 2018), requires each state to establish a State Advisory Group to advise on the administration of juvenile justice and delinquency prevention programs and federal grant funding administered by the United States Department of Justice; and
WHEREAS, the Committee is well-suited to serve as such an advisory board consistent with federal law; and
WHEREAS, Exec. Order No. 312, 39 N.C. Reg. 344-345 (October 1, 2024), which was issued on August 29, 2024, is set to expire on August 31, 2026; and
WHEREAS, the Governor has determined that extending Executive Order No. 312 is necessary to ensure the continued operation of the Committee as North Carolina's State Advisory Group and to maintain the State's compliance with applicable federal law; and
WHEREAS, pursuant to Article III § 1 of the North Carolina Constitution and N.C. Gen. Stat. §§ 143A-4 and 143B-4, the Governor is the chief executive officer of the state and is responsible for formulating and administering the policies of the executive branch of state government; and
WHEREAS, pursuant to N.C. Gen. Stat. §147-12, the Governor has the authority and the duty to supervise the official conduct of all executive and ministerial officers.
NOW, THEREFORE, by the authority vested in me as Governor by the Constitution and the laws of the State of North Carolina, IT IS ORDERED:
Section 1. Extending Executive Order No. 312
Pursuant to N.C. Gen. Stat. § 147-16.2, Executive Order No. 312, which extended the Juvenile Justice Planning Committee is hereby extended to August 26, 2028.
Section 2. Effect and Duration
This Executive Order is effective immediately and shall remain in effect until August 28, 2028, or until rescinded or superseded by another applicable Executive Order.
